When is the best time to book a Bed and Breakfast in Ballydehob?
The best time to book a B&B in Ballydehob is from May to September, with July being the most popular month among travelers. This vibrant period showcases the lush Irish countryside in full bloom, making it ideal for outdoor enthusiasts who appreciate the beauty of nature. The long, sunny days provide ample opportunities for hiking, exploring charming coastal paths, and indulging in the local arts scene.

During summer, you can expect mild temperatures ranging from the mid-50s to low 70s Fahrenheit, creating a comfortable setting for sightseeing and enjoying the local culture. The lively atmosphere is enhanced by various festivals and events,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the community's warm hospitality and rich traditions.

For those looking for a more budget-friendly experience, consider visiting in October. This month offers beautiful autumnal landscapes, fewer crowds, and a chance to enjoy the tranquil charm of Ballydehob. The fall colors create a picturesque backdrop for leisurely walks and cozy evenings in local pubs.
